#0b42bc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0b42bc is composed of 4.3% red, 25.9%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.1% cyan, 64.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 221.4 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 39%. #0b42bc color hex could be obtained by blending #1684ff with #000079.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

Shades and Tints of #0b42bc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000103 is the darkest color, while #eff4fe is the lightest one.
